Pixelcraft steps back, proposes handing control to Aavegotchi’s DAO

Aavegotchi

 

Pixelcraft Studios, the team that built and stewarded the Aavegotchi project and games, is stepping back from its role as the project’s default lead studio.

 

In a blog post, the studio outlined a structured transition window running from 1st June 1 to 1st September 2026, during which the Aavegotchi DAO is being asked to decide how key responsibilities should be handled.

 

The assets in scope are substantial: Aavegotchi IP and trademarks, creative assets, aavegotchi.com and related web properties, Discord, X, YouTube, GitHub, NPM, SDKs, documentation, repos, technical assets, contributor coordination and ongoing ecosystem operations.

 

But this is not an automatic transfer. Pixelcraft’s preferred direction is for the DAO to take more direct stewardship where appropriate, with formal transfers and access changes requiring governance approval and implementation.

 

The reason is blunt. Pixelcraft says it was unable to turn the DAO’s last major funding round into either a self-sustaining studio model or a reliable protocol revenue engine.

 

The studio says its burn rate was roughly $300,000 per month when those funds were initially transferred, later reduced to around $200,000 after its Geist L3 was terminated, and then lower from there. Its remaining runway is now limited, with resources focused on critical infrastructure, transition support and remaining company obligations.

 

Three products — Gotchi Guardians, DeFi Dungeon and Gotchiverse 3D — should no longer be assumed to be under active Pixelcraft studio development. They may still be preserved, archived, maintained in limited form or built on by others, but any return to active development will likely need to come through DAO-led teams, independent contributors, new studios or funded proposals.

 

The core protocol remains live, fully onchain and migrated to Base.

 

Existing NFTs, GHST, wearables, parcels, Gotchis and other ecosystem assets are not being migrated or altered by the announcement. Holders do not need to connect wallets, migrate assets or sign anything. The announcement is not a technical migration or token event. It is an operating-model reset.

 

Pixelcraft frames the move as both philosophical and financial. Aavegotchi, it argues, should not default back to a single-studio dependency. Members Coderdan, goldenXross and Xibot plan to remain active in the community, but as contributors among others rather than as the automatic centre of control.

 

The post also points to broader crypto regulatory discussions, including the CLARITY Act, as part of the case for reducing centralized control, limiting special permissions and making governance more transparent.

 

The DAO now has a difficult practical agenda. It must decide whether to accept stewardship of the IP and trademarks, whether some creative assets should become CC0, who should manage social media and documentation, how to handle GitHub and other technical assets, and what budget should support ongoing infrastructure costs such as hosting, subgraphs, tooling, domains, technical maintenance, moderation and communications.

 

Pixelcraft expects to cover the estimated $4,000 legal cost of the trademark transfer, but the wider operating model will require proposals, votes and execution.

 

This is a pattern we are seeing more frequently in blockchain gaming. Studios that raised during the 2021-22 cycle, shipped products into a bear market and failed to find sustainable product-market fit are now facing hard choices. Some shut down entirely.

 

Others, like Pixelcraft, attempt to hand more responsibility to the community — a move aligned with web3 values but operationally difficult. DAOs can vote, but live game operations require speed, accountability and consistent execution.

 

The 1st September review point will be telling. If the Aavegotchi DAO can organise itself, fund operations and attract new builders, it could become a genuine case study in decentralised game stewardship. If not, the risk is that transition becomes a more polite word for slow fade.
